Microwave equipment market down 8% in 3Q09; Huawei posts big gains

The total worldwide microwave equipment market hit $1.4 billion in 3Q09, down 8% from 2Q09, reports Infonetics Research. The report added that the market is dominated by mobile backhaul microwave equipment, and as more service providers upgrade their networks to HSPA+ and LTE, the need for enhanced mobile backhaul bandwidth will continue to drive the microwave equipment market.  more

Microwave & Satellite Emerge as Strong Backhaul Options

As mobile network operators scramble for ways to backhaul growing volumes of traffic, microwave, millimeter, and satellite technologies are emerging as important alternatives to wireline options provided by local telcos, according to the latest report from Unstrung Insider.  more

36 Million Femtocell Shipments in 2012

The wave of interest in femtocells continues to gather momentum, and with a number of sizeable carrier RFPs currently in circulation, the market looks set to see rapid growth over the next few years. By 2012 the market for femtocells looks set to represent 36 million shipments with an installed base of nearly 70 million femtocells serving over 150 million users. more
